Linux学习笔记
当前位置:Linux学习笔记 > Linux 软件 > 正文

无限轮播条 swift版 CarouselBannerView

bbs.yuanmawu.net.jpg

用swift编写的轮播条,需要在controller 里实现三个协议

func scrollView(toScrollView scrollView: CarouselBannerView, andImageAtIndex index: NSInteger, forImageView imageView: UIImageView) {

 

        imageView.kf_setImageWithURL(NSURL(string: imageSource.objectAtIndex(index) as! String)!, placeholderImage: UIImage.init(named: "banner_bgImage"))  //通过网络图片地址显示图片

     }

    

    func numberOfImageInScrollView(toScrollView scrollView: CarouselBannerView) -> Int {

        return imageSource.count  //图片个数

    }

    func  scrollView ( toScrollView scrollView : CarouselBannerView, didTappedImageAtIndex  index : NSInteger){

     print("点击\(index)")  //图片点击事件

    }

未经允许不得转载:Linux学习笔记 » 无限轮播条 swift版 CarouselBannerView

赞 (0)
分享到:更多 ()